Transaction 62b88f70cfc0ba62f90d59c2014cb7b7ea9871bc906bd5142853792adca9c8af

1 Input
1 Outputs
  • 62b88f70cfc0ba62f90d59c2014cb7b7ea9871bc906bd5142853792adca9c8af:0
  • value  17818508
    address  1FoZJXhpNRAgyJr6bfEqFHZRNZML4jnzAD